Regrading Around Foundation Cost: Price Factors, Ranges, and How to Save 2026
Homeowners typically see costs for regrading around a foundation range from $2,500 to $12,000, depending on soil conditions, access, and the extent of grading needed. The price is driven by spoil removal or disposal, fill material, compaction, and any drainage adjustments. Understanding the cost components helps buyers compare quotes and plan a budget for the project.
| Item | Low | Average | High | Notes |
|---|---|---|---|---|
| Total Project | $2,500 | $6,000 | $12,000 | Includes materials, labor, and basic permits |
| Per Square Foot | $1.50 | $3.50 | $6.50 | Based on 1,000–2,000 sq ft area |
| Fill Material | $0.75 | $2.25 | $4.50 | Granular backfill or topsoil varies by region |
| Labor | $1,000 | $2,500 | $5,000 | Crew size and local rates affect total |
| Equipment | $300 | $1,200 | $2,800 | Excavator or skid steer needed for heavy grading |
| Permits/Inspections | $50 | $500 | $2,000 | Depends on city and scope |
| Disposal | $200 | $1,000 | $3,000 | Dump fees or hauling away soil |
Typical total price for regrading Around a Foundation
Cost range overview: Most residential projects fall in the low-$2,500 to high-$12,000 band, with the median around $6,000. A small, shallow regrade in sandy soil near a simple rectangular foundation tends toward the lower end, while multi‑level homes with clay soils and restricted access push toward the higher end. Assumptions: standard access, midrange soil quality, normal weather window.

How soil type and slope affect regrading costs
Soil composition and existing slope are major cost drivers. Clay soils require more moisture management and deeper removal, increasing both labor and equipment time. Sandy soils may settle differently, prompting more grading rounds. Cost impact example: clay soil may add 20–40% to labor hours compared with well-draining loam.
Regional price differences for regrading around foundations
Prices vary by region due to labor rates, disposal costs, and material availability. The Northeast and West Coast commonly see higher hourly rates and permit fees than the Midwest or Southeast. Region-based delta: roughly ±25% to ±40% compared with national averages.
Labor time, crew size, and scheduling for a 1,500–2,000 sq ft footprint
A typical crew of 2–3 workers tackles projects in 1–3 days for a 1,500–2,000 sq ft area, depending on access and weather. Estimate: 16–40 hours scheduled work; 2–3 workers on site.
Permits, inspections, and code considerations for foundation regrading
Most municipalities require a grading or drainage permit if work affects drainage or stormwater runoff. Inspection checkpoints often include slope compliance and soil compaction standards. Expect permit costs from $50 up to $2,000 depending on locality and project scope.
Material options: fill dirt, compacted backfill, and soil stabilization
Choice of fill influences price and long-term performance. Granular fill with proper compaction costs more upfront but reduces future settlement risk. Lime or cement stabilization adds expense but benefits heavy-use foundations. Per sq ft ranges: $0.75–$4.50 for fill materials.
Practical ways to reduce the price without compromising results
Cost-saving strategies focus on scope clarity and scheduling. Options include combining grading with drainage improvements, using standard fill rather than premium mixes, and coordinating with other exterior projects to save mobilization costs. Careful planning can trim 10–30% of total cost.
Sources of price variation to watch in bids
Two common quotes may differ because of equipment rental length, haul distance, or disposal method. Always compare per‑square‑foot and per‑hour components, not just totals. Ask for a side-by-side line-item comparison with material and labor separately listed.
